Sensitive material

Do not submit confidential evidence through this form.

The form has no upload facility and the server rejects attachment submissions. A separate protected contact protocol is being prepared. Until it is published, do not send names, testimony, images, recordings, device details or documents that could expose a survivor, witness, family member or source.

Before contacting us

Reduce unnecessary exposure.

  • Do not use a work or shared deviceif doing so could reveal your communication or identity.
  • Do not send original files casuallybecause images and documents can contain identifying metadata.
  • Do not name another person without considering riskespecially when they have not consented to disclosure.
  • For a correction, identify the exact passageand provide a source or explanation that can be assessed.
